![]() | ![]() | |
|---|---|---|
| Layer 1: Identity & Trust | ||
| Manufacturer Country | China | China |
| Year First Available (values differ) | — | 2025 |
| Verified Deployments | 0 Deployments | 0 Deployments |
| Layer 2: Operational | ||
| Price (values differ) | $48,659–$64,869 USD | $99,995–$314,286 USD |
| Battery / Shift Runtime (values differ) | 4 hrs | 2 hrs |
| Availability Status | ACTIVE | ACTIVE |
| Layer 3: Category Specific | ||
| Physical Form Factor | ||
| Height (values differ) | 1180 mm | 176 mm |
| Weight (values differ) | 30 kg | 95 kg |
| Mobility Type (values differ) | — | bipedal |
| Humanoid Subtype (values differ) | — | full bipedal |
| Walking Speed (values differ) | — | 2 m/s |
| Stair Climbing (values differ) | — | Yes |
| Terrain (values differ) | indoor | flat indoor, stairs |
| Payload & Dexterity | ||
| Payload (values differ) | — | 52 kg |
| Total DOF (values differ) | 41 | 52 |
| Arm DOF | 7 | 7 |
| Hand DOF (values differ) | — | 7 |
| Bimanual Coordination (values differ) | — | Yes |
| Compute & AI | ||
| Onboard Compute (values differ) | NVIDIA AGX Orin 200 TOPS | X86 + NVIDIA Jetson Orin |
| VLM Capable (values differ) | — | No |
| Foundation Models (values differ) | — | false |
| Imitation Learning (values differ) | — | No |
| Programming (values differ) | code_ros, code_python, proprietary_app | code_ros |
| Battery & Power | ||
| Runtime | 2 hrs | 2 hrs |
| Battery Swap (values differ) | — | Yes |
| Software | ||
| SDK Languages (values differ) | code_ros, code_python, proprietary_app | Python |
| ROS Support | Yes | Yes |
| Open API | Yes | Yes |
| Reliability | ||
| Deployment Maturity (values differ) | — | commercial |
| Commercial | ||
| Price (USD) (values differ) | $48,659–$64,869 USD | $99,995–$314,286 USD |
| Price Tier (values differ) | 40-80K | 80-150K |
| Pricing Model | purchase | purchase |
| Warranty (values differ) | 1 yrs | — |
| Applications (values differ) | research, education, embodied_ai, teleoperation | industrial automation, 24/7 manufacturing |

Who makes Booster T1 with Dexterous Hands and Walker S2?
Booster T1 with Dexterous Hands is made by Booster Robotics, based in CN. Walker S2 is made by UBTECH Robotics Corp Ltd., based in CN.
How do Booster T1 with Dexterous Hands and Walker S2 compare on the Robo Index?
Booster T1 with Dexterous Hands grades BBB on the Robo Index. Walker S2 grades AA. The Robo Index is a credibility grade (AAA … C) that blends commercial maturity, verified deployments, company standing, and independent coverage — see methodology for the full breakdown.
Are Booster T1 with Dexterous Hands and Walker S2 in the same category?
Both robots are classified as Humanoid on Robolist. Filters and ranking treat them as direct alternatives.
